Output e2d5c43dfaafeec5fcf797f38b2d3b0422b72c1dd8aac85e887cbe53c9848296:27

value
89000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ccfbc53d67e582f61c5f622bd03b7d249aba0b66 OP_EQUAL
address
3LNsNzihSY9B6uqyBZffMgMiv8NL245Jsm
transaction
e2d5c43dfaafeec5fcf797f38b2d3b0422b72c1dd8aac85e887cbe53c9848296